Lawyer Johnnie Cochran, who famously defended actor O.J. Simpson, has died aged 67 at his home in Los Angeles, California.

He had a long bout with cancer.

Johnnie L. Cochran, Jr was born October 2, 1937 at Charity Hospital in Shreveport, Louisiana. He was raised in Los Angeles, California. He attended UCLA, and received his law degree from Loyola Marymount University.

Johnnie Cochran, Jr. began his legal career in Los Angeles as a Deputy Attorney for the city's criminal division. Cochran worked his way through the ranks to accept a position as Assistant District Attorney for Los Angeles County.

In his long carreer he fought for women's and civil rights for all.
